Sedimentary rocks are also called stratified rocks. Why?
Why sedimentary rocks are called stratified rocks?
Advertisements
Solution
During the formation of sedimentary rocks, the sediments are deposited in waterbodies and get sorted out according to their size. The sediments accumulate in different layers or strata arranged one above the other. Each layer or stratum has particles of given size. In sedimentary rocks each layer or stratum has particles of a given size. Therefore, sedimentary rocks are also called stratified rocks.
